Why do volcanoes usually form at plate boundaries?

Answer:

When plates move away from each other at divergent plate boundaries, interesting things happen. For example, when plates move apart, molten rock from the Earth's core ascends and forms new crust. ... This molten rock can rise up to the surface, forming a volcano, and causing volcanic eruptions.
